Spain On This Day - May 23


Saints Days: Desiderio and Florencio. Nuestra Señora del Milagro.

1482 - The abencerrajes entered the Albaicín and proclaimed Boabdil as the King of Granada

1493 - The Catholic Kings order a new contingent of 25 horses from the Kingdom of Granada to be sent to the new world
1533 - The marriage between Enrique VIII & Catalina de Aragón was annulled.
1568 - The Netherlands became independent of Spain
1823 - A French expedition, the 100 sons of San Luis, entered Madrid without any resistance to re-establish the sovereignty of Fernando VII
1845 - The Spanish ‘cortes’ voted for a new constitution
1986 - Mario Vargas Llosa received the Prince of Asturias prize for the Arts
2004 - in Antequera proclaimed as Patron of the City Holy Christ of Health and Waters in Ancient Collegiate Church of Santa Maria Maggiore. Celebrated by the Bishop of Malaga, Mons. Antonio Dorado Soto

Births
1606 – Juan Caramuel y Lobkowitz, mathematician and philosopher (d. 1682)
1811 - José de Salamanca y Mayol, businessman and politican.
1855 - Enrique de las Morenas y Fossi, solidier and one of the last Phillipinos.
1872 - Eduardo Hernández-Pacheco y Estevan, archeologist (d. 1965).
1892 - Pichichi (Rafael Moreno Aranzadi), footballer.
1905 - Ramiro Ledesma Ramos, politican and writer (d. 1936).
1923 – Alicia de Larrocha, Catalan-Spanish pianist (d. 2009)
1930 - Jordi Solé Tura, politican (d. 2009).
1931 - José Luis Coll, comic and writer (d. 2007).
1952 - Federico Trillo, PP politican.
1965 - Manuel Sanchís, footballer.
1973 - Santiago Eximeno, writer.
1973 – Juan José Padilla, bullfighter
1974 - Monica Naranjo singer
1983 - Natalia Hernández Rojo, journalist.
1997 – Pedro Chirivella, footballer


Deaths
1627 - Luis de Góngora, poet and dramatist.
1842 - José de Espronceda, poet.
1882 - José María Marchessi y Oleaga, soldier (b. 1801).
2004 – Ramon Margalef, ecologist (b. 1919)
2005 - Sígfrid Gracia, footballer (b. 1932).
2008 – Iñaki Ochoa de Olza, mountaineer (b. 1967)
2009 - José-Miguel Ullán, poet and journalist (b. 1944).
2011 – Xavier Tondo, cyclist (b. 1978)
